在MyBatis-Plus中使用DATE_FORMAT函数,可以方便地对数据库中的日期时间字段进行格式化处理,从而满足各种查询需求。下面将详细解释如何在MyBatis-Plus中使用DATE_FORMAT函数,并提供相关的代码示例。 1. 理解MyBatis-Plus的基本用法和特性 MyBatis-Plus是MyBatis的增强工具,提供了许多便捷的功能,如自动生成SQL、分页插件、...
DATE_FORMAT() 函数用于以不同的格式显示日期/时间数据。 语法 DATE_FORMAT(date,format) 1. date 参数是合法的日期。format 规定日期/时间的输出格式。 可以使用的格式有:看上边 实例 下面的脚本使用 DATE_FORMAT() 函数来显示不同的格式。我们使用 NOW() 来获得当前的日期/时间: DATE_FORMAT(NOW(),'%b %...
mysql datatime 用 mybatisplus 的什么类型来接 mybatis dateformat,MyBatis以封装少、高性能、可优化、高灵活度等特性成为当今最流行的Java互联网持久层框架。开胃菜JDBC编程最早之前Java程序都是通过JDBC(JavaDataBaseConnectivity)连接数据库的。然后我们可以通过SQL对
= ''"><!-- 开始时间检索 --> and date_format(create_time,'%y%m%d') >= date_format(#{beginTime},'%y%m%d') </if> <if test="endTime != null and endTime != ''"><!-- 结束时间检索 --> and date_format(create_time,'%y%m%d') <= date_format(#{endTime},'%y%m%d'...
例如:last("DATE_FORMAT(create_time, '%Y-%m-%d') = '2022-01-01'") 这些方法可以通过QueryWrapper或LambdaQueryWrapper中的apply方法进行使用。例如: QueryWrapper<User> wrapper = new QueryWrapper<>(); wrapper.apply("DATE_FORMAT(create_time, '%Y-%m-%d') = '2022-01-01'"); List<User> user...
import java.text.SimpleDateFormat; import java.util.Date; import java.util.Locale; publicclassDateUtil {publicstaticThreadLocal<DateFormat> chinaDateSDF =newThreadLocal<DateFormat>() { @OverrideprotectedDateFormat initialValue() { SimpleDateFormat df=newSimpleDateFormat("yyyy-MM-dd", Locale.CHINA)...
直接接收到字符串的时间,将他转为 date类型,之后在xml里面,进行接收 写法是 代码语言:javascript 代码运行次数:0 运行 AI代码解释 public static Date stringToDate(String date, String format){ SimpleDateFormat simpleDateFormat = new SimpleDateFormat(format); return simpleDateFormat.parse(date); } 根据 ...
{LocalDatedate=LocalDate.now();returntableName +"_"+ date.format(DateTimeFormatter.ofPattern("yyyyMM"));//表名增加月份后缀}returntableName +"_"+ MONTH_DATA.get();//表名增加月份后缀}else{returntableName;//表名原样返回} } } 1.3 用法 ...
会有 sql 注入风险 !! * 例1: apply("id = 1") * 例2: apply("date_format(dateColumn,'%Y-%m-%d') = '2008-08-08'") * 例3: apply("date_format(dateColumn,'%Y-%m-%d') = {0}", LocalDate.now()) * * @param condition 执行条件 * @return children */ Children apply(boolean co...
SELECT user_id, username, DATE_FORMAT(create_time, '%Y-%m-%d %H:%i:%s') AS formatted_time FROM user ```markdown 1. 2. 3. 在这个SQL语句中,我们将数据库表user中的create_time字段格式化为"yyyy-MM-dd HH:mm:ss"的字符串,并且将其命名为formatted_time。